Pair of 19th Century French Neoclassical Painted & Gilt Enameled Porcelain Vases

About the Item

Decorate a mantel, a console or a buffet with this colorful pair of antique vases. Hand crafted in France circa 1870 and attributed to the Porcelain de Paris Manufacture, the tall vessels stand on an integral round base over a circular base extending to a wide convex neck at the top. The large urns are hand-painted with outdoor pastoral scenes. One scene depicts a gentleman carrying his wife over the water while the kid is holding a lamb crossing the river. The other scene features a mother with her two children walking on a bridge, and carrying hand picked fresh flowers. Both base, neck and rim are embellished with gilt decor throughout. The important neoclassical vessels are in excellent condition commensurate with age and use, and adorn rich enameled colors.. Measures: 13.75" diameter 17" height.
